Course Code | Course Title | Course Description |
---|---|---|
Anthro 10 | Bodies, Senses and Humanity | Interaction of biology and culture in the shaping of humanity |
Archaeo 2 | Archaeological Heritage: The Past is not a Foreign Land | A survey of archaeological research and its role in the development of knowledge about the collective human past, and its contribution to heritage in the contemporary world |
Arkiyoloji 1 | Ang Pilipinas: Arkiyoloji at Kasaysayan | Ang kasaysayan ng Pilipinas nakasentro sa kaalaman mula sa arkiyoloji, at ugnayan ng sinaunang kasaysayan ng rehiyon sa kasaysayan ng Pilipinas |
Art Stud 2 | Art Around Us: Exploring Everyday Life | |
ARTS 1 | Critical Perspectives in the Arts | A critical study of the experience, language, and context of art |
Bio 1 | Contemporary Topics in Biology | Recent developments in biology and pertinent concerns on the nature of life, health and related social issues |
Chem 1 | Chemistry: Science that Matters | Basic chemistry concepts relevant to everyday life |
CW 10 | Creative Writing for Beginners | A workshop exploring the potentials of creative writing as expression, as discipline and as a way of thinking about the society in which we live |
DRMAPS | Disaster Risk Mitigation, Adaptation, and Preparedness Strategies | Introduction to principles and practices of natural disaster risk management by mitigation of, adaptation to, and preparedness for risk, through all related disciplines aiming for resilience |
Econ 11 | Markets and the State | Essential economic concepts and their use in analyzing real-world issues |
EL 50 | European Cultures and Civilizations | Europe’s contributions to world cultures, civilizations, and languages |
Eng 11 | Literature and Society | The critical study of various literary genres as a dynamic interaction between the individual and social and cultural forces |
Eng 12 | World Literatures | The study of representative/landmark texts from the literatures of the world |
Eng 13 | Writing as Thinking | A course in critical thinking, reading, and writing in English |
Eng 30 | English for the Professions | Principles and uses of writing in English in the various disciplines/professions |
Env Sci 1 | Environment and Society | Introduction to principles and concepts in the study of the natural environment within a societal framework |
ETHICS 1 | Ethics and Moral Reasoning in Everyday Life | The nature and development, sources and frameworks of ethics and moral reasoning and their application to various issues and contexts |
FA 28 | Arts in the Philippines | Art and art making the Filipino way |
FA 30 | Art Pleasures | The fine art of enjoying art |
Fil 18 | Oryentasyong Filipino sa Akademikong Pagsulat | Akademikong pagsulat sa Filipino na may mapanuri, malikhain, at makabayang lapit |
Fil 30 | Intelektuwalisasyon ng Filipino sa mga Pananaliksik sa Akademikong Disiplina | Pag-aaral tungkol sa pananaliksik sa Filipino sa iba’t ibang disiplina at larangan sa kontekstong panlipunan at pangkultura |
Fil 40 | Wika, Kultura, at Lipunan | Ang relasyon ng Filipino sa kultura at lipunang Pilipino |
Film 10 | Sining Sine | Film as art and social practice |
Film 12 | Sine Pinoy | Philippine cinema as art form and cultural product |
FN 1 | Food Trip | Food and nutrition in daily living |
GE 1 | Earth Trek | A guided exploration into the tools and techniques of earth observation and measurement |
Geog 1 | Places and Landscapes in a Changing World | Overview of the diversity of interconnections of peoples and places in a globalizing world as mediated by cultures, politics and historical developments |
Geol 1 | Our Dynamic Earth | The study of how the earth works, its place in the universe; and relationship between people and the physical environment |
KAS 1 | Kasaysayan ng Pilipinas | Ang pampulitika, pang-ekonomiya, panlipunan, at pangkalinangang pagsulong ng Pilipinas |
Kas 2 | Ang Asya at ang Daigdig | Ang pamanang pangkalinangan ng Asya sa pagkakaugnay at ang kaugnayan nito sa kabihasnang pandaigdig |
L Arch 1 | Designing Eden: Introduction to Philippine Landscape Architecture | Walking-through Philippine landscape architecture through sciences and arts |
Lingg 1 | Ikaw at Wika Mo | Mga pangunahing konsepto tungo sa pag-unawa, paggamit, at pagpapahalaga sa wika bilang produkto ng talino ng tao sa kanyang pang-araw-araw na pakikipag-ugnayan, at higit sa lahat, sa konteksto ng sitwasyong pangwika sa Pilipinas |
LIS 10 | Information and Society | Appreciation of the role of information in human endeavors in the context of its creation, management, dissemination, and use in an increasingly information-driven society |
Math 2 | Mathematics in Everyday Life | Basic mathematical concepts and skills in everyday life |
MATH 10 | Mathematics, Culture and Society | Appreciation of the beauty and power of mathematics through the examination of its nature, development, utility, and its relationship with culture and society |
MBB 1 | Biotechnology and You | Historical events, processes, products, issues, and concerns in modern technology |
MS 1 | Oceans and Us | The functional balance between the health of the oceans and the survival and improvement of our way of life |
MPs 10 | Ang Hiwaga at Hikayat ng Panulat sa Filipino | Malikhaing pagbasa at masining na pagsulat ng mga natatanging anyong pampanitikan, kasama ang mga makabagong anyong teknolohikal |
Pan Pil 17 | Panitikan at Kulturang Popular | Ang relasyon ng panitikan at popular na kultura sa kasalukuyan |
Pan Pil 19 | Sexwalidad, Kasarian at Panitikan | Pag-aaral ng interaksyon ng panitikan at mga usapin sa seksuwalidad at kasarian |
PHILARTS 1 | Philippine Arts and Culture | Approaches to Philippine Arts and Culture |
Philo 1 | Philosophical Analysis | Application of basic concepts, skills and principles drawn from the Philosophy of Language, Symbolic Logic, Epistemology, Philosophy of Science and Ethics |
Philo 10 | Approaches to Philosophy | Overview of major philosophical traditions |
Philo 11 | Logic | Techniques of formal deduction within the scope of sentential and predicate logic |
Physics 10 | Physics and Astronomy for Pedestrians | A “walk-through” course for people who want to enjoy physics and astronomy |
SAS 1 | Self and Society | Understanding the self by examining the interaction of biological, psychological and socio-cultural dimensions and appreciating human agency and the emergence of the self in different social contexts |
SEA 30 | Asian Emporiums: Networks of Culture and Trade in Southeast Asia | An introduction to the world of monsoon Asia as formed by interaction among its peoples throughout the centuries |
Speech 30 | Public Speaking and Persuasion | Persuasion in various public speaking situations |
Soc Sci 2 | Social, Economic and Political Thought | A survey of social, economic & political thought from classical to contemporary times |
Socio 10 | Being Filipino: A Sociological Exploration | A sociological examination of persistent issues of nationhood, selfhood and citizenship in Philippine society |
STS 1 | Science, Technology and Society | Analyses of the past, present and future of science and technology in society (including their nature, scope, role and function) and the social, cultural, political, economic and environmental factors affecting the development of science and technology, with emphasis on the Philippine setting |
Theatre 11 | Dula at Palabas | An introductory survey to Philippine theatre from rituals to contemporary forms |
Theatre 12 | Acting Workshop | An introduction to the art and skill of acting for the theatre |
